  • Forced to watch adds to progress

    This game, like many, features optional, extra rewards for watching adds (rewards like a free upgrade to your mine truck or a mining boost). Of course, there are also non-optional ads that pop up throughout the game as well, but for the most part, they aren’t too excessive to the point where it ruins the game. The beginning of the game was as I expected: satisfying, and I could easily progress on my own without the option ads

    My problem with the game didn’t arrive until a couple hours in - at around level 15 it becomes almost impossible to upgrade your mining truck fast enough without watching an ad. Of course, you can always just mine at a slow pace with your blades flaring up red, but it takes so long to gather enough “ores” to purchase the next upgrade. Once you hit level 18, you’re so far behind in upgrades that you almost have to only upgrade your mine truck through ads.

    I don’t mind a game that gives you the option to progress with ads, but they shouldn’t make the game unplayable to the point where you have to watch ads for it to play smoothly. 2/5 stars.

  • Barely any content once you get past the ads

    As the title; strip out the relentless adverts and you’re maxed out in an hour, the levels just repeat or at least feel like it.

    Also paying to remove ads doesn’t actually remove them, still get the banners and sudden ones in the middle of a level, just means you can skip after 10 instead of 30 seconds.

    Could have been fun but it’s yet another mindless ad barrage because developers seem to think they’ll make a fortune off them.
